WHAT IS THE ELIGIBILITY TO STUDY BSC IN STATISTICS?AND SUGGEST THE BEST COLLEGE IN MUMBAI?

Deepshikha Student Expert 31st Jul, 2019
Hey,
The eligibility to study Bachelor of Science in Statistics is that you should pass 12th from any recognized board with Mathematics as one of the main subjects from Science stream with minimum 50 percent. While some universities conduct entrance Test,the others take admission on the basis of 12th marks.
